The research goal in our lab is to unravel some of the key mechanisms controlling proper neural development, from the centrosome/cilia axis to neurogenesis.

Amazing findings from the Hoijman Lab @EstebanHoijman at @IBMB_CSIC: embryos eliminate bacterial infections via epithelial phagocytosis, well before the immune system is in place — conserved from fish to humans! doi.org/10.1016/j.chom…
How innate immunity starts? Early embryos eliminate bacterial infections by epithelial phagocytosis, a conserved process from zebrafish to human embryos. cell.com/cell-host-micr…
Check out our new paper in @nature nature.com/articles/s4158…. We report genetic mechanisms of neural tube defects in patients. Spina bifida is also known as meningomyelocele (MM). Prior family-based and association studies found few linked genes, so we took a different approach.
